According to legislation, every business needs a Health & Safety file. The Safety File should include all documentation required in terms of the Occupational Health and Safety Act and the file must be kept on site and be made available to inspectors for review.

A site specific safety file is NOT optional but required by Law. Failure to produce a site specific Safety File can lead to a fine and/or imprisonment. A Health and Safety File, otherwise known as a ‘Safety File’ is a record of information focusing on the management of health and safety on construction sites for contractors and sub-contractors. It protects the employer from criminal liability and proves compliance to the Occupational Health and Safety Act and Regulations.
